Granite; merely cut, by sawing or otherwise, into blocks or slabs of a rectangular (including square) shape

HS v2022 Code: 251612

About granite; merely cut, by sawing or otherwise, into blocks or slabs of a rectangular (including square) shape

HS code 251612 covers granite that has been cut, by sawing or other means, into rectangular or square blocks or slabs. Granite is a widely used natural stone material known for its durability, strength, and aesthetic appeal. This industry plays a crucial role in the construction, architecture, and landscaping sectors, providing essential raw materials for a variety of applications.

Production process

The production of granite blocks and slabs under HS code 251612 typically involves several key steps. First, large granite boulders or quarried blocks are extracted from the earth using heavy machinery. These raw blocks are then transported to processing facilities where they are cut, trimmed, and polished using specialized saws, grinders, and other cutting tools. The final products are rectangular or square granite pieces, ready for use in various construction and design projects.

Production inputs

The main inputs required for the production of granite blocks and slabs under HS code 251612 include the raw granite material, which is sourced from quarries and mines. Additionally, the industry relies on various tools and machinery, such as saws, grinders, and polishing equipment, as well as energy sources, transportation, and skilled labor to facilitate the extraction, cutting, and finishing processes.

Production outputs

The primary outputs of the industry covered by HS code 251612 are rectangular or square granite blocks and slabs. These products are widely used in the construction, architecture, and landscaping industries, where they are often incorporated into buildings, monuments, countertops, flooring, and outdoor hardscaping. The outputs of this industry may be further processed or consumed by industries covered under other HS codes, such as 680221 Marble, travertine, alabaster, worked, and articles thereof, simply cut or sawn, with a flat or even surface and 680223 Granite, worked, and articles of granite, simply cut or sawn, with a flat or even surface.
